METEOR OPEN HOUSES - Aug 12/07 PDF Print E-mail

The Meteor Shower Open house was a great success

For those that ventured out we had a great view of a number of deep sky objects , a look at the space station flying over and then a long nite of meteors...a great nite...thanks to all who came and enjoyed the show.

The Perseid Meteor Shower will peaking on Sunday Night, but incase the weather does not cooperate I have also scheduled a Friday session.  I will be starting 9:30 both evenings.  If your coming for the Meteor shower, bring a comfortable lawn chair and sit back and watch the sky from a fairly dark sky.

Saturn is gone until winter, but Jupiter is still up.  We can have a look at its storm bands and its moons  There will be no moon glow to worry about so we can have a look at a number of deep sky objects (see my gallery), I will post a map in the gallery section on how to get to the observatory site.

Everyone welcome, its free!Smile
